THIAZOLE CARDIOVASCULAR AGENTS
-
, (2008/06/13)
1-Alkylamino-3-(5-carbocyclicalkylaminocarbonylthiazol-2-yloxy)-2-propan ol;5-(5-carbocyclicalkylaminocarbonylthiazol-2-yloxymethylene-N-alkyloxazol idin e and/or 2-substituted oxazolidine derivatives thereof, and methods of making such compounds. The compounds exhibit cardiovascular activity and are useful in the treatment of abnormal heart conditions in mammals. The compounds are also useful in the treatment of hypertension in mammals. The 5-(5-carbocyclicalkylaminocarbonylthiazol-2-yloxymethylene)-N-alkyloxazolid ines and derivatives are also intermediates for the 1-alkylamino-3-(5-carbocyclicalkylaminocarbonylthiazol-2-yloxy)-2-propanols . The 1-alkylamino-3-(5-carbocyclicalkylaminocarbonylthiazol-2-yloxy)-2-propanols can be prepared by base or acid hydrolysis of the corresponding 5-(5-carbocyclicalkylaminocarbonylthiazol-2-yloxymethylene)-N-alkyloxazolid ine or derivative; or by treatment of the corresponding 3-(5-carbocyclicalkylaminocarbonylthiazol-2-yloxy)-2,3-epoxypropane with the desired alkylamine. Similarly the 5-(5-carbocyclicalkylaminocarbonylthiazol-2-yloxymethylene)-N-alkyloxazolid ine or derivative can be prepared from the corresponding 1-alkylamino-3-(5-carbocyclicalkylaminocarbonylthiazol-2-yloxy)-2-propanols via treatment with an aldehyde or ketone.
